Best Articles Site is a company, located at 119th Avenue Southeast, Bellevue, Washington 98006, United States. Visit their website www.bestarticlessite.com for more detailed information.
BestArticlesSite.com is a well known site for article submission.
Tags : #Establishment
Location :
119th Avenue Southeast, Bellevue, Washington 98006
Added by
Jopie, at 01 January 2020